Chronic inflammation describes an ongoing, long-term response to endogenous or exogenous inflammatory stimuli and is characterized by continued accumulation of mononuclear leukocytes (macrophages and lymphocytes), accompanied by tissue injury due to the prolonged inflammatory response. Most of these cells are phagocytes, certain “cell-eating” leukocytes that ingest bacteria and other foreign particles and also clean up cellular debris caused by the injury. 1-3 The lack of awareness of type 2 inflammation means people may not fully understand their disease(s), how they are connected, and the treatment options available … A.
